Ep. 1 The Koshi Rikdo Assassination Plot Filler Oct 7, 1999
The ENTIRE anime deliberately diverges from Rikdo Koshi's manga at the publisher's own request (not padding while waiting for source material to publish, but a wholesale reimagining the creator approved of) — every episode is anime-original, confirmed directly (animefillerlist.com classifies all 26 episodes filler, 100%). A genuinely different case from every other show in this catalog: the manga existed first, but the anime was never intended to adapt it.
